Citations
2 citations on file for this inspection.
1926.501 B13
- Issued
- Sep 19, 2016
- Penalty
- Initial $4,988 · Current $2,500 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): "Residential construction." Each employee eng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els shall be prot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system unless another provision in paragraph (b) of this section provides for an alternative fall protection measure. Workers were engaged in residential construction activities re-roofing a single-family house. Workers were exposed to potential fall hazards between 11.0 and 19.0-feet in that a proper fall protection system was not utilized.

1926.503 A01
- Issued
- Sep 19, 2016
- Abate by
- Nov 4, 2016
- Penalty
- Initial $4,988 · Current $0 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.503(a)(1): The employer shall provide a training program for each employee who might be exposed to fall hazards. The program shall enable each employee to recognize the hazards of falling and shall train each employee in the procedures to be followed in order to minimize these hazards. . Workers were engaged in residential construction activities re-roofing a single-family house. Workers were exposed to potential fall hazards between 11.0 and 19.0-feet in that the workers were not properly trained in fall protection criteria.
